Motherwell FC are today delighted to confirm that promising young star Shaun Hutchinson has signed a two-year contract extension.
Hutchinson, 20, roared back into the first-team in the second half of last season; new boss Stuart McCall managing to get the England U21 hopeful back to the form that made him a standout at the beginning of the 2009/2010 campaign.
His contract was due to expire next summer but after penning a new deal, he is now tied to the club until June 2014.
The young defender said, “As soon as the club made it known they were keen to extend my contract I was delighted to sign.
“I am really enjoying my football and to have the security for another three years is brilliant. The second part of last season was going great; the only disappointment being the season had to end as I was ready for another half.
“I also really enjoy working with Stuart McCall. His training is excellent and he has all the players really bursting a gut for him. It’s a great environment for any player, particularly one who is young and looking to develop their career.”
Chief Executive Leeann Dempster said, “This is a further demonstration of our commitment to producing and nurturing young talent at the club; we’re absolutely delighted Shaun has agreed to extend his deal. Finding and keeping the best talent is critical to the future development of our football club.
“We have an overriding strategy here at Motherwell and this type of deal sits at the very core of it.
“There was interest in Shaun from some big clubs on both sides of the border but we have opted not to cash in on him at this point and under the stewardship of our excellent management team here at Fir Park, we know we can bring his game on even more.
“He has also shown real loyalty to the club and a desire to play and no praise is high enough as far as I am concerned.”
